I went to buy a new car. The first tried to sell it to me at the MSRP. I showed them a print out from carsdirect.com. The agreed to that price. I went to finance it, and surprise, surprise... they want me at the MSRP. I showed them a print out from carsdirect.com. The agreed to that price. I went to finance it, and surprise, surprise... they wanted about 50% down and 7% interest which came out to the MSRP again. The salesman I was dealing with was a nice guy and new, and was telling me that, maybe if my credit was better they could do 5.3%... but couldn't apply that to the lower price. The manager showed me a print out from Honda to 'confirm'. It was one or the other. I was about to walk out, and he says "let me see what I can do". The manager or whomever then says 'oh, I misread it. Here it says you can't combine, here it says you can." They weren't sure, and he would call me back first thing the next day. I called my salesman near the end of the next day... his manager hadn't told him one way or the other yet. I called Paramus Honda. I told them the carsdirect.com price and they said, "our price is lower." It was. On the same day, I came home with a car from them. It was my first car buying experience. I learned the difference between a good and a bad dealer. More
